Abstract

The utility model relates to the technical field of dust removal devices, in particular to a water spraying dust removal device which comprises a dust removal bin, a dust suction mechanism is connected to the side face of the dust removal bin, two filter boxes are arranged in the dust removal bin, and the outer side faces of the two filter boxes are connected with the interior of the dust removal bin through sealing plates. Two filter boxes are arranged in the mounting shell, a spraying mechanism is arranged above the two filter boxes, two screen plates are arranged in each of the two filter boxes, a plurality of stacked PVC polyhedral hollow balls are arranged between the two screen plates, and a plurality of fan-shaped plates which are spirally arranged are arranged in the mounting shell. According to the scheme, more PVC polyhedral hollow balls are arranged in the filter box, the size of gaps of the PVC polyhedral hollow balls is larger than that of pores of a filter screen, airflow penetrates through the gaps of the PVC polyhedral hollow balls, the resistance of the airflow is reduced, the speed of the airflow is increased, and then the dust removal efficiency is improved.

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of dust removal equipment technology, and in particular to a water spray dust removal device. Background Technology

[0002] In existing technologies, dust removal operations typically employ methods such as gravity settling, inertial separation, filtration, wet adsorption, or electrostatic adsorption. These technologies often involve initial filtration of large dust particles from the gas, followed by a second filtration of smaller dust particles using electrostatic or wet adsorption. However, when gas passes through the filter screen, the small pore size causes a decrease in gas velocity. This low-velocity airflow makes it easier for dust to deposit on the filter screen surface, forming a "dust cake" that clogs the pores, reducing the filter's filtration efficiency and overall dust removal effectiveness. [0011] Compared with the prior art, the present invention has the following beneficial effects:

[0012] This solution incorporates numerous PVC hollow spheres within the filter box. As airflow rubs against the surface of these spheres, the spheres, being made of plastic, readily generate static electricity, which adsorbs dust particles from the airflow. Furthermore, the larger pore size of the PVC hollow spheres compared to the filter screen allows airflow to pass through these pores, reducing airflow resistance, increasing airflow speed, and ultimately improving dust removal efficiency. [0032] Working principle: During dust removal operation, the fan 3 is first powered on. The fan 3 drives the airflow in the dust removal chamber 23 and the two filter boxes 24 to circulate. The airflow carrying dust passes through multiple dust suction hoods 2, air ducts 4 and air inlet pipes 6 and is discharged into the bottom space of the dust removal chamber 23. The dust-laden airflow is then transported to the dust removal chamber 23 and dispersed into the two mounting shells 7. The dust-laden airflow collides with multiple fan-shaped plates 12. Large dust particles in the dust-laden airflow will impact the surface of the fan-shaped plates 12 due to inertia. Some of the large dust particles are attracted to the bottom due to electrostatic adsorption or fall off due to their large mass, which is used for preliminary filtration of dust in the dust-laden airflow.

[0033] After preliminary filtration, the dust-laden airflow is transported to the filter box 24. The dust-laden airflow flows through the gaps of multiple PVC multi-faceted hollow spheres 9 and generates static electricity by friction on their surfaces. Dust is adsorbed by electrostatic adsorption and used to filter the dust in the dust-laden airflow again.

[0034] At the same time as the fan 3 starts, the submersible pump 22 is powered on synchronously. The submersible pump 22 delivers the aqueous solution from the water source to the inner cavity of the two filter boxes 24 through multiple nozzles 21. The water mist sprayed from the multiple nozzles 21 can adsorb the dust in the airflow in the filter box. The dust-laden droplets captured by the water agglomerate and become larger. Due to gravity, they settle to the bottom of the dust removal chamber 23 inside the equipment, thus filtering the dust three times.

[0035] Some of the water mist is transported by the fan 3 through two exhaust branch pipes, the exhaust main pipe and the fan 3 to the demister box 1, and then discharged into the external environment after being dried in the demister box 1.
